Jake Shears, Sheila E., Steve Grand part of 2019 Market Days lineup
2019-05-21

This article shared 1917 times since Tue May 21, 2019
facebook twitter google +1 reddit email


CHICAGO—The Northalsted Business Alliance ( NBA ) brings the beats to Boystown for this year's Northalsted Market Days, set for Aug. 10-11. The fest returns with five stages of non-stop entertainment, shopping, food and more.

Music icon Shelia E., Jake Shears, Steve Grand, Deborah Cox and Brian Justin Crum ( America's Got Talent ) are among the popular acts slated to perform. Popular local and national acts complete the line-up.

Formed in 1980, NBA represents more than 100 businesses along the Halsted Street corridor. The organization hosts major events throughout the year including Chicago Pride Fest, Northalsted Market Days and the Halloween Parade. For information about NBA visit Northalsted.com .
